Artificial intelligence (AI) will create more opportunities, similar to what happened more than a century ago, when tractors moved into farms, displacing some farm workers, but making farming a better business. As those farms became mechanized, the number of people employed in agriculture dropped, but farm outputs and productivity accelerated. The old Rev Malthusian postulation that man (and woman) would run out of food due to food production accelerating in arithmetic progression in a world growing in population geometrically, was evidently punted for good.

Today, in the European Union, less than 5% of the working population are employed in agriculture, and yet, they produce enough to eat and export. In Africa, we hover in the excess of 65%, producing poverty where farmers need help with food!

The AI race is opening another phase of that massive labour translation where most people in some of the things we do would be displaced and dislocated. The invention of AI and the new species of AI systems were experiencing will have consequential impacts in the natures and forms of work.

As ChatGPT blasts its scientific magics, Google is putting Mind into Brain: Google Brain and DeepMindthe companys two main AI units, which have long operated separatelywould work together more closely on efforts to build large algorithms. I expect a lot more, stronger collaboration, because some of these efforts will be more compute-intensive, so it makes sense to do it at a certain scale together, Google CEO Sundar Pichai.

As that happens, a new basis of competition has been opened by Google: Google published details about its AI supercomputer on Wednesday, saying it is faster and more efficient than competing Nvidia systems. While Nvidia dominates the market for AI model training and deployment, with over 90%, Google has been designing and deploying a chip, called Tensor Processing Unit, for artificial intelligence since 2016, partially for internal use.

Yes, the hardware will create a separation. Apple won the mobile world by creating proprietary hardware that powers exclusive software. Google understands that redesign and is going for an x-factor. Indeed, for the AI systems to advance at the software level, the hardware which crunches the bits and bytes must evolve. If you control that evolution in machines, you win the race. Every software is limited by the hardware which runs it; expanding that nexus will provide massive opportunities. That explains why Apple will play a role because it knows how to make great chips especially for consumer markets.

Hardware will advance and AI systems will accelerate in performance, and what happened in farms more than a century ago will begin to take place at scale in companies. But as that happens, AI will make the European labour laws go global as technology redesign causes dislocations in markets. Yes, you cannot just fire workers and governments will demand that as adoption begins to transform industries.

After announcing the largest rounds of layoffs in their history, US big tech companies are now learning how difficult it is to reduce headcount in Europe.

In the US, companies can announce widespread job cuts and let go of hundreds if not thousands of workers within months and many have. Meanwhile, in Europe, mass layoffs among tech companies have stalled because of labor protections that make it virtually impossible to dismiss people in some countries without prior consultations with employee interest groups.

This has left thousands of tech workers in limbo, unsure about whether theyll be affected by negotiations that can drag on indefinitely.
